Arsenal punished struggling Southampton with two first-half goals to move back into the top four of the Premier League
The Gunners led when Alexandre Lacazette reacted quickest to turn in Henrikh Mkhitaryan's shot with the Saints' claims for offside proving futile
And they doubled their lead shortly after when Mkhitaryan drilled a shot into the bottom corner.
Arsenal should have scored more in a dorminant first half, but ultimately it mattered little as those goals were enough to move Unai Emery's side above Manchester United, who drew at home to Liverpool.
